  • Oh!.  Excuse me while I crawl under my desk and hide my face.

    You can ignore all those lines from the log file entries I've been posting.  Those are from the DAZ Studio log file.  I just found the one for LAMH.  And never mind about the plane.  I just loaded a different animal and the plane looks like it's part of LAMH.   Think I'll go back under the desk now....

    Peeks back out... but it is consistently and reliably crashing every time I enable and disable a Surface.  Loaded ToonKitty in DS, load LAMH editor, selected kitty, clicked Select from Surface, clicked Cornea, waited for eyeball to turn red, clicked X in upper right corner of the Select Surface box since there's no OK/Cancel buttons.  Clicked Select from Surface again, unchecked Cornea and it crashes.  I'll send y'all my log file.

     

    The crash on disabling a surface was recently reported and a fix has been made.  An update will be released shortly.

    There is a ground plane in the LAMH UI.  It was added at the request of some advanced users who wanted to know where the "ground" in DS was in reference to the figure.  This is really just the 0 plane that DS presents and does not notate any ground plane that may be loaded otherwise.  It can be turned on/off by clicking on the blue gear in the lower right corner of the LAMH UI and using the checkbox there.
